public class DefaultFailureEnricherContext extends Object implements org.apache.flink.core.failure.FailureEnricher.Context
FailureEnricher.Context class.| Modifier and Type | Method and Description |
|---|---|
static org.apache.flink.core.failure.FailureEnricher.Context |
forGlobalFailure(org.apache.flink.api.common.JobInfo jobInfo,
org.apache.flink.metrics.MetricGroup metricGroup,
Executor ioExecutor,
ClassLoader classLoader)
Factory method returning a Global failure Context for the given params.
|
static org.apache.flink.core.failure.FailureEnricher.Context |
forTaskFailure(org.apache.flink.api.common.JobInfo jobInfo,
org.apache.flink.metrics.MetricGroup metricGroup,
Executor ioExecutor,
ClassLoader classLoader)
Factory method returning a Task failure Context for the given params.
|
static org.apache.flink.core.failure.FailureEnricher.Context |
forTaskManagerFailure(org.apache.flink.api.common.JobInfo jobInfo,
org.apache.flink.metrics.MetricGroup metricGroup,
Executor ioExecutor,
ClassLoader classLoader)
Factory method returning a TaskManager failure Context for the given params.
|
org.apache.flink.core.failure.FailureEnricher.Context.FailureType |
getFailureType() |
Executor |
getIOExecutor() |
org.apache.flink.api.common.JobInfo |
getJobInfo() |
org.apache.flink.metrics.MetricGroup |
getMetricGroup() |
ClassLoader |
getUserClassLoader() |
public org.apache.flink.metrics.MetricGroup getMetricGroup()
getMetricGroup in interface org.apache.flink.core.failure.FailureEnricher.Contextpublic org.apache.flink.core.failure.FailureEnricher.Context.FailureType getFailureType()
getFailureType in interface org.apache.flink.core.failure.FailureEnricher.Contextpublic ClassLoader getUserClassLoader()
getUserClassLoader in interface org.apache.flink.core.failure.FailureEnricher.Contextpublic Executor getIOExecutor()
getIOExecutor in interface org.apache.flink.core.failure.FailureEnricher.Contextpublic org.apache.flink.api.common.JobInfo getJobInfo()
getJobInfo in interface org.apache.flink.core.failure.FailureEnricher.Contextpublic static org.apache.flink.core.failure.FailureEnricher.Context forTaskFailure(org.apache.flink.api.common.JobInfo jobInfo,
org.apache.flink.metrics.MetricGroup metricGroup,
Executor ioExecutor,
ClassLoader classLoader)
public static org.apache.flink.core.failure.FailureEnricher.Context forGlobalFailure(org.apache.flink.api.common.JobInfo jobInfo,
org.apache.flink.metrics.MetricGroup metricGroup,
Executor ioExecutor,
ClassLoader classLoader)
public static org.apache.flink.core.failure.FailureEnricher.Context forTaskManagerFailure(org.apache.flink.api.common.JobInfo jobInfo,
org.apache.flink.metrics.MetricGroup metricGroup,
Executor ioExecutor,
ClassLoader classLoader)
Copyright © 2014–2025 The Apache Software Foundation. All rights reserved.